H.R. No. 1549


R E S O L U T I O N
WHEREAS, Wash Allen of KCOH-Radio in Houston has achieved outstanding success in the field of broadcasting during a remarkable career that has spanned 45 years; and WHEREAS, Currently the only African-American radio personality in the Houston market with a national radio show, Mr. Allen began his tenure in broadcasting at the age of 15 with WDIA-Radio in Memphis, Tennessee; he also worked at radio stations in Nashville, Tennessee; Cleveland, Ohio; Washington, D.C.; and Detroit, Michigan; before making his home in Houston at KCOH; and WHEREAS, Mr. Allen's extensive experience in the industry as a broadcaster, program director, and operations manager has given him a broad-based understanding of the medium and how best to meet the expectations of its audience; and WHEREAS, Indicative of Mr. Allen's stature in his field, Billboard Magazine named him one of the top three broadcasters in the United States and also awarded him its annual Radio Programming Forum Award; and WHEREAS, Mr. Allen is a tremendous asset to KCOH-Radio, as well as a welcome presence on the airwaves to his legion of listeners nationwide; now, therefore, be it RESOLVED, That the House of Representatives of the 78th Texas Legislature hereby congratulate Wash Allen on his many notable achievements in radio broadcasting and extend to him sincere best wishes for continued success; and, be it further RESOLVED, That an official copy of this resolution be prepared for Mr. Allen as an expression of high regard by the Texas House of Representatives.
